>What time is used for the email messages? I thought it was client, but that
>doesn't always match. It doesn't seem to be the server time either though.
>Where does this mysterious time come from?
When you send an E-mail, your E-mail client should add the time to the
Date: header of the E-mail. However, some clients do not add the time, in
which case the mail server usually adds it.
